Had the Thai burrito with seitan. Really flavorful. The cashier told us the rice and beans were not made with any animal products like many Mexican places. Love the chips and salsa choices. Small section to sit against wall for in house dining though many were getting takeout.
Not bad for an Easy coast Mexican vegan option
I was visiting from CO and my friend and i wanted something quick, yummy and that had vegan options. I’m over Chipoodle so she suggested B Y S. I got the tofu bowl, Med heat level, bbq sauce. It was really good, definitely higher quality than Chipoodle. I’d definitely go there again in a pinch!
We eat here or the Springfield location weekly... seitan tacos or burritos are GREAT—even better now that they have vegan queso!!! My husband loves their non-veg omni options too...
The Springfield location on Sumner Rd is the best one we’ve been to (others including this one in West Springfield are good too)
Good sized restaurant, counter service. Precisely one burrito that is a vegan option, a fair number of vegetarian ones though. Seitan available to replace meat in most/all dishes, but no vegan cheeses for those who need them.
So glad to find this place while traveling. Love that they had seitan and tofu protein options. I had the East Meets West burrito. It was like chinese takeout in a tortilla. So good! Hope I get to try the other unusual burrito choices they had someday too
This is the best burrito/taco chain I've ever visited. Every menu item can be made with your choice of meats, tofu, or mock-meats. We both had burritos with seitan, and they were AMAZING.
The food was good, filling, fast, and inexpensive. I wish this chain had locations outside of Massachusetts, because it's really awesome. Definitely go here.
